It usually takes 12 to 24 hours for MiraLAX (polyethylene glycol 3350) to take effect—according to Harish Gagneja, MD, a board-certified gastroenterologist at Austin Gastroenterology in central Texas—but it can take up to 96 hours in some cases. SU. suzanne66 10 Dec 2011. The" discard after date" applies to the miralax and water mixture (and is usually 24 hours) and the expiry date applies to the dry powder. The dry powder will be fine to use until it passes the expiry date. +0. Related topics. miralax, expiration. Further information. Similar questions. Search for questions.

Unused medicine: Throw away any expired or unused MiraLAX. Do not flush the medicine down the toilet. The best way to dispose of medicines is through your local waste disposal company or a medication take-back program. Learn more about proper medication disposal. No. Most expiration dates are placed as a quality measure... the point after which the manufacturer can no longer ensure that at least 90% …How do you dispose of expired miralax? How to Safely Dispose Medicine. Mix medicines (do not crush tablets or capsules) with an unpalatable substance such as kitty litter or used coffee grounds. Here's What You Need to Know • MiraLAX...Official answer. by Drugs.com. For relief of constipation, you can take one dose of MiraLAX at any time of the day for up to 7 days. You may prefer to take it early in the day so that it’s less likely you will have a bowel movement during bedtime or late at night. MiraLAX usually produces a bowel movement in 1 to 3 days.

Learn More.Polyethylene glycol 3350 is a laxative used to prevent or treat occasional constipation and hard stools. It works by pulling water into the stool to promote bowel movements and soften the stool. It may take 2-4 days for the medicine to work. This medicine is available over-the-counter (OTC) without a prescription.For oral solution: A packet with powder for reconstitution with water to 1 gallon.
